Authors of the essay have attempted, based on ego-documents, to reveal the borderlines of the discrepancy between the expected standard of intensity and duration of the Austro-Prussian conflict and the subsequent reality. One of the 19th-century modernizing processes condensed in the short and intense clash in the summer of 1866 when in consequence of increased density of the traffic infrastructure and the introduction of new communication and infrastructure networks, the world seemed ‘smaller’ and ‘faster’. The essay brings an analysis of the period discourse that the authors understand not only as a frame within which memories and events were performed, but also as a product of mnemonic processes.
